[ ] Key ceremony step 7 (Pairwell matching service): before rotating the signing keys, confirm the matcher's GC pause metrics are below 40 ms p99, since long pauses during rotation have previously caused match-window drift. Verify the dashboard, note the reading in the ceremony log, then unseal the ceremony workstation. Unsealing prompts for the recovery passphrase, recorded on the next line for the sync.

unlock words, yawig-kagef: gordor-holvan-ulaael-pramir-ulaiel-tamdor

Finance Review Summary — Harwick Street Lease

For the finance team: renegotiation of the Harwick Street depot lease concluded this month. Landlord Pellgrove Estates agreed a five-year term with a 9% reduction in annual rent and a break clause at year three. One-off legal and refit costs are within the approved envelope. Savings flow through from next quarter. The confidential note on related plans appears directly below.

management briefing: Project Ulavan slips by two quarters because of the staffing delay.

# Quarterly Planning Note — Sale of the Fieldworks Unit

Sales leads: as flagged at the offsite, Corravale Industries intends to divest the Fieldworks instrumentation unit to Ambervale Partners during Q4. Pipeline accounts tied to Fieldworks should be flagged by mid-month so handover terms can be agreed. Commission protections will apply through close, per the framework Ines Tarrow circulated. Customer communications remain embargoed until the announcement. The rationale and next steps are outlined in the confidential note below.

board note of kageg-bahof: The renewal with Holwynax Holdings closes at $2 million a year, 5 percent below the last contract. Project Ulaath slips by two quarters because of the supplier delay.

Hey Tomas — handing off the SQL lint rules for Quillbase. Heads up: the uppercase-keywords rule is now a warning, not a blocker, after the migration team complained. New rules go through the style council before merge, so don't freelance. Test fixtures are in the lint repo. The full rule catalog and rationale are on the wiki page.

wiki page, tahaf-tajog: https://jira.ordindyn.corp/pipeline